maggie's_beer reviewed Belgian Beer Cafe Oostende, Adelaide
Cafes, Music Venues, Belgian, European, Child Friendly
7.2 Recommended
Food 8 Drinks 8 Ambience 7 Service 6 Value 7
Always a good venue for drinks and food. The beer selection is extensive so it is always fun to try something new. Food is done incredibly well. I recommend the waterzooi - fruit de mer (creamy seafood soup). It's incredibly rich (so wash it down with beer) but those garlic croutons are the best invention. Adds incredible texture and flavour to the meal.

maggie's_beer reviewed Regattas Bistro, Adelaide
Bars, Mediterranean, Modern Australian, Bistro/Brasserie, BYO
6 Average
Ambience 4 Service 8 Value 6
I liked how this place was nice and big, big enough to avoid a christmas party but it also has a lot of thoroughfare being situated in between the main stairs and the conference room on the other side. The view is overrated. We could only see tree tops.
Service was excellent. Staff were friendly and knowledgeable about the food. They also showed great initiative which is rare. Food was a bit below average though. Presentation was lovely but the pasta I had was a bit beyond al dente so all it was a plate of scraggly pieces.
I would recommend this place for a medium sized work function. It's not too fancy so well within budget but the impeccable service makes it feel special.
